Katharina Grosse
Untitled, 2019
Acrylic on canvas, 240 × 161 cm
Familie Holle Hamburg

In the process of making this painting Grosse layered stencils at different times onto the canvas, creating well-defined borders within which colorful, heterogenous forms populate the image. The forms appear to be still undergoing mutations, especially those at the edges of the canvas. Although they intersect and overlap with the other shapes, overlaid on the white background like a collage, their rectilinear aspect nevertheless also invokes a framing device. This reminds us of the concept of painting as a window onto the world. The work thus prompts us to critically reconsider the relationship of art and world and how a frame functions as a separation.
